"Endless Bouken Spirits! Gogo Sentai Boukenger!"

The Boukengers are a Sentai team based in the SGS offices, that search for the 'Precious', items deemed even more valuable than esteemed treasure. They are aided by Zubaan.

Team History

The Search Guard Successor Foundation (SGS) is a global, non-governmental organization set up throughout the world for the searching, obtaining and maintenance of Precious, mysterious objects of massive power from the civilizations and societies of the past. However this is a task of great danger and difficulty: the obstacles for the obtaining the Precious are many and difficult, compounded with many of these objects possessing great danger just to be collected. Further complicating the matter are those who wish to gain the Precious themselves for their own wicked, evil purpose; these organizations are collectively known as the Negative Syndicates.

In order to combat the Negatives and safely obtain Precious even with the dangers they possess, SGS developed various advanced technology for usage in the field. Most of this technology is linked in truth to ancient studies by Renaissance scientist Leon Giordana, who had created blue prints and concepts that were centuries ahead of his time. The most important technology that Giordana theorized was that of the "Parallel Engine", a powerful machine that both allowed for powering vehicles but, more importantly, can be linked up to a human to allow for them to use the power of the vehicle for combat and survival.Task 11: The Showdown on the Isolated Island With the power of this engine alongside special suits for the usage of it's power, it's user can obtain enhanced strength and durability for Precious missions and face against those who used them for evil or selfish reasons.

Yet with the technology for the mission, it is the hearts of the people performing the missions that are the true soul of SGS. Five special people notable for their skills and abilities for handling difficult missions and surviving any odds were recruited to accomplish the Precious hunts. Empowered by the Parallel Engines of five vehicles, they have come together under the name of the "Boukenger". These five are:

Gokaiger

Years later, the Space Empire Zangyack invaded Earth. This threat was so great that all of the first 34 Super Sentai, including the Boukengers, were needed to oppose them. The 34 Sentai put up a valiant fight against the ground forces, but when the Zangyack fleet itself attacked them, Akarenger told everyone to combine their powers and save the Earth. This destroyed the Zangyack fleet and resulted in the loss of their powers, which resurfaced as Ranger Keys, that were dispersed throughout the universe. In the immediate aftermath of the battle, Satoru, alongside Saki Rouyama (Go-On Yellow) of the Go-ongers, informed the Goseigers that they destroyed the Zangyack's first invasion.

The keys were collected by AkaRed, and later utilized by the 35th Super Sentai, the Gokaigers, a group of five people from different planets who came to Earth in search of the Greatest Treasure in the Universe. Ep. 1: The Space Pirates Appear During the battle against the Black Cross King, Satoru was one of several Super Sentai warriors who granted their greater powers to the Gokaigers. Gokaiger Goseiger Super Sentai 199 Hero Great Battle Later, Satoru later visited the GokaiGalleon, asking for the Gokaigers aid in retrieving the Heart of Hades, a powerful Precious. In the adventure that followed, Satoru encountered the revived King Ryuuwon, who was defeated by the Gokaigers. Ep. 21: The Adventurer Heart

After the Gokaigers finally defeated Zangyack, they returned the Ranger Keys before they left Earth to find the second Greatest Treasure in the Universe. It is assumed the Boukengers have their powers back. Final Ep.: Farewell Space Pirates

Super Hero Taisen

The Boukengers, among the majority of the Super Sentai heroes, were caught up in the "Super Hero Taisen" incident which eventually resulted in the Super Sentai teams and Kamen Riders joining forces to defeat both Dai-Zangyack and Dai-Shocker. The Boukengers were not accompanied by BoukenSilver who, like other additional heroes, was strangely absent in this event. Kamen Rider × Super Sentai: Super Hero Taisen

Akibaranger

BoukenRedInAkibaranger2
Bouken Red appears to encourage AkibaBlue.
Magicknight94Added by Magicknight94

An imaginary Bouken Red appear twice alongside the "unofficial" Sentai team, Hikonin Sentai Akibaranger, in the third episode, after AkibaRed says his catchphrase "Boukenger, Attack!", wearing his "lucky outfit". Later, he appears to encourage AkibaBlue and transforms into Bouken Scooper. Ep. 3: Pain Touch! Drunken Hero Adventure!!

Ranger Keys

Boukenger Ranger Keys
The Boukenger Ranger Keys.

The GoGo Sentai Boukenger Ranger Keys (轟轟戦隊ボウケンジャーレンジャーキー Gōgō Sentai Bōkenjā Renjā Kī?) are what became of the Boukengers' powers after they along with the rest of the 34 Super Sentai sacrificed their powers to end the Great Legend War.

Any of these keys allow a Gokaiger to assume the form of any of the Boukengers or summon DaiBouken to attack the enemy before giving GokaiOh the GoGo Ken for the Gokai Adventure Drive attack. Note: The Bouken Red Key is first used by Gokai Blue in Epic on Ginmaku.
